Hi Gurus,
While doing contract imports, the issue is that the scanned pdfs for the contracts do not get uploaded as the 'Final Signed Document' in the contract. Is there an extra step required to attach the scanned pdfs as final signed document? Is there any import template available for this?
Please let me know how I can automate this.

Hi Arjun,
we did some testing here, and this will not be possible. You are able to import additonal fields such SIGNED_DOC but you can't attach a document to it. The importer right now is only able to handle contract documents but not "attachments" to additional fields.
Could you please create an enhancement request via CSN ?

Hi Arjun,
one of my colleagues in Product Management looked into this issue as well and has proposed the following as a potential feature request. If possible, please provide us with feedback on this option:
If we were able to provide a field within the contract Importer that stored the file name path as a link would that be a sufficient work around to being able to import a separate attachment file that contains the Final-Signed-Document ?

The issue with the link option is that you then need a separate repository for the final signed document! That I think defeats the whole idea of CLM being the single repository for contracts. So, I think we really need to have a way to upload the final signed document as an attachment.
I understand there is some complication in including this in the contract import functionality because the field opens up only when the Contract is moved to Executed phase. So, I think if you provide a separate import object just to import the final signed document that should also be fine.
